Description

In the frozen wilderness of the Canadian north, a seasoned corporal of the Mounted Police follows a faint sled trail that promises to lead to a notorious outlaw known as Koona Dick. The crisp pine air, the disciplined bark of his sled dogs, and the crunch of snow underfoot set the scene for a tense pursuit that suddenly veers into danger when the crack of rifles shatters the silence and a terrified woman’s scream pierces the trees. With his senses on high alert, the officer must decide whether to press on toward an unseen homestead or retreat into the safety of the main road.

The mystery deepens as a lone figure—a woman moving swiftly through the dimming forest—appears on a side trail, forcing the corporal to pause and confront the unknown. As night falls and the trail disappears into darkness, the promise of a hidden settlement beckons, hinting at secrets that could unravel the chase and reveal the true nature of the cry that echoed through the woods.

About the author

OB

Ottwell Binns

1872–1935

A prolific British storyteller and Unitarian minister, he filled his fiction with adventure, mystery, and a touch of the uncanny. His books range from detective puzzles to lost-world fantasy, making him an intriguing rediscovery for readers of early twentieth-century popular fiction.
